CHAVEZ -- Mary L. Chavez, 92 years young, a resident of Albuquerque, passed into the Lord's hands on Tuesday, September 11, 2007. Mary is survived by her two children, Bernie and Elaine; her son-in-law, Tom DeLand; her sister, Thelma Fischer; and many nieces and nephews. Mary was one of five children born in Winslow, AZ on October 4, 1914 to Guadalupe and Santa Cruz Leal. Although Mary did not finish high school, she had a PhD in life. She received her GED so she could obtain her beautician's license. She successfully owned and operated her own beauty shop in Gallup. Mary fell in love and married John Hudson Chavez on September 9, 1939 in Gallup. After giving birth to her son, Bernie, she gave up her beauty shop so she could raise him. With Mary, family always came first. Mary Chavez accomplished so many things in her life--first and foremost she was a great wife and wonderful Mother. In addition to the beauty shop, she owned and operated a restaurant. Although extremely busy, she became President of the PTA, owned and managed several apartments, worked as a waitress, ran a concession on Sundays for her husband's Gamerco Miners baseball club. She cared for her Mother for several years until she passed away. Mary lovingly raised her two children Bernie and Elaine, who never knew a babysitter. These accomplishments were just the tip of the iceberg. Mary often wondered how she did it all, as do her children. Although they hated leaving Gallup and all of their friends there, Mary and Hudson moved to Albuquerque in 1991. Mary missed her friends in Gallup but knew moving to Albuquerque was really a good decision. She immediately established many good friends in her little community of Towne Park. Mary was a Christian and loved her new church--Temple Baptist. Mary lost her husband, Hudson Chavez, on March 6, 2003. So at the age of 87, she decided to buy a new and larger house so her son, Bernie, could move in with her. Bernie took good care of his Mom for five years. Her daughter and son-in-law, Elaine, and Tom DeLand moved to Albuquerque from San Francisco, CA in 2005 to help care for Mary and to be close to her as she advanced in age. Everyone who met Mary loved her. She was always ready to listen to anyone's problems and did not hesitate to give her advice, which was always "right on". Mary had a big heart and returned her love to everyone she met. She rarely said no to any request made of her. Mary will be missed by all her friends and acquaintances, but no one will miss her more than her children, Bernie and Elaine. She was their Rock of Gibraltar. A Memorial Service for Mary will be held at 10:30 a.m. on Saturday, September 15, 2007 at the Temple Baptist Church, 1613 Arizona NE, Albuquerque, NM.
